MINNEAPOLIS - Former Minnesota Twins great Kirby Puckett suffered a stroke Sunday morning and was undergoing surgery.
Twins announcer John Gordon said on WCCO Radio that Puckett was having surgery at a Scottsdale, Arizona, hospital.
The 44-year-old Puckett led Minnesota to two World Series championships and is a member of the Hall of Fame.
